Mandy Selzer (Regina, SK) needed a tiebreaker to advance to the playoffs, Selzer finished 2-1 in the 14-team qualifying round. . In their opening game, Selzer lost
5-3 to Sherry Just (Saskatoon, SK), then responded with a 5-2 win over Shalon Fleming (Regina, SK). Selzer won 6-3 against Brett Barber (Biggar, SK) in their final qualifying round match.
 
Selzer earned 1.912 world rankings points for their preliminary round wins. Selzer gained -1.166 points improving upon their best 3 events, though dropped 7 spots on the World Ranking Standings into 103rdplace overall with 29.611 total points. Selzer ranks 133rd overall on the Year-to-Date rankings with 1.912 points earned so far this season.
